> Recently, we remotely installed fresh IDES ECC 6.0 SR2 system on Win 2003 with SQL Server 2005.
>
> At the time of installation we got couple of error like
>
> Warning: The SQL Server Standerd Edition is not supported for the Productive Operation. Press OK to continue your installation.
Well - that error is pretty self explanatory. You are using an unsupported database. SAP systems are only supported on Enterprise editions of SQL Server.
Apparently that system was "manually" installed not using the DVDs provided by SAP.
> Got this error messages more then 38 times in ST22 code
>
> STORAGE_PARAMETER_WRONG_SET
That is a memory related error which can happen because you're reaching the 2 GB per-process memory limit on 32bit systems.
I suggest:
- Reinstall the system with a supported database version
- use 64bit
Markus

  • Opening the system for configuration

    Hi Guys,
    In some cases, we open the SAP system to do some configuration for certain tables.
    We have to request the Basis team to open the SAP system..What exactly do we mean by this opening of the system?
    Are we allowing the customization of certain tables which is otherwise not possible in the Quality system?
    And we again need to close the system..What is the purpose of this opening/closing....
    thanks
    srik.

    Usually they lock the client for configuration or any changes. they do this in order to avoid inconsistencies between clients.
    This is set up for QA and Production where they want to centralize all developments and changes in one client and transport the changes.
    Sometimes, there are configurations that are done manually in each client. In this case, BASIS team needs to allow changes in the system using SCC4.

  • Windows could not finish configuring the system error after sysprep /generalize

    Hi
    I just installed Windows 7 Ultimate RTM off from technet and as always I do make use of WIM images on having them deployed to my home PC's
    I was able to have it installed on a clean machine and once the wizard appeared i immediately entered Audit mode (shift+ctrl+f3) and the usual I loaded all of the software i need to pre-install after I was done I Immediately loaded sysprep and had it with the generalized option
    now this is where the problem begins....... after it restarts during the "Setup is starting Services" screen it gives me a message box error saying "Windows could not finish configuring the system. To attempt resume configuration, restart the computer" and once I press ok it jsut restarts and gives the same error again.
    This does not happen when i dont select the generalize option in sysprep.
    Anyone who had the same issues?

    I now have the ACTUAL SOLUTION to this problem.  This solution will actually tell you exactly what registry key is causing your sysprep to fail, so then you don't have to slowly install
    every program until you find the problem -- especially since this didn't work for me because my problem has been intermittent.
    This issue is caused by certain registry keys that are either:
    a) Larger than 8kb
    b) Set with incorrect permissions
    c) Corrupt in some way
    For me, the problem was intermittent (same registry key would sometimes cause the issue and sometimes not - must be corrupt sometimes) so it was impossible to tell what program was doing it.  Luckily, there is a log you can look at that will tell you
    exactly what registry key is erroring out.  Here are the steps for getting the log you need to see:
    When you see the error message, do the following:
    1.) Push Shift+F10 to get to a command prompt
    2.) Navigate to C:\windows\Panther
    3.) Find the Setup.etl file and find a way to copy this file off of the system (I copied it to the D:\ partition and used Ghost to gather that partition and get the file off)
    4.) Copy the setup.etl file from the corrupted system to another computer that has Windows 7.  Put it on the root of C:\ for easiest access.
    5.) Open a Command Prompt on the Windows 7 computer.
    6.) Navigate to the root of C:\ (or wherever you saved the file)
    7.) Type "tracerpt setup.etl -o logfile.csv"
    8.) Close the command prompt and open up logfile.csv in your text editor of choice. 
    9.) Look through the log file (towards the end probably) for messages that say "Failed to process reg key or one of it's decendants"  For me, the exact eror looked like this: "Failed to process reg key or one of its descendants: [\REGISTRY\MACHINE\SOFTWARE\ESET\ESET
    Security\CurrentVersion\Plugins\01000200\Profiles\@My profile]"  If you search for "reg key" or "failed to process" you should find the failure.
    10.) Remove this software from your image, or find out how to get the registry key that is failing to work properly.
    After this, you should be able to properly identify any problem keys and remove/workaround them on your image.

  • I just installed LV2011 and one dll from my vi won't load with the error "application configuration is incorrect"

    I just installed LV2011 and one dll from my vi won't load with the error "application configuration is incorrect", which is Windows lingo for "missing package dependencies".  All the computers at my company with 2010 loaded seem to do OK.  When I do a Dependencies Walk I get missing Visual C debug dll's missing plus IEshims and wer which both have a whole tree of dependencies missing on my machine.  The Windows install is the same "Windows XP version 2002 Service Pack 3" on my PC and the working PC's. So I'm thinking I have to uninstall 2011 and go back to 2010.  Is this correct?  Those VC debug dll's were installed on the machines with 2010 in them but were not installed in mine.
    I've heard the advice to recompile the dll with debug turned off but I don't have access to the source code.
    Thanks in advance.

    u87 wrote:
    Thanks for the reply.  This at least tells me that going back to LV2010 is not likely to solve the problem.  The missing dll's are:
    MFC90D.dll
    MSVCR90D.dll
    IESHMS.dll
    WER.dll
    And, once again, IESHMS and WER have other dependencies.  So perhaps i need to install the Visual C++ development environment.
    IESHIMS.dll is an Internet Explorer DLL that gets usually delay loaded by shdocvw.dll. As delay load it can not cause DLL load errors but only runtime errors. Maybe your DLL has it as direct dependency but that is unlikely since it does not have a documented interface.
    WER.dll is Windows error reporting for Vista/Win7.
    MFC90D.dll is the Microsoft Foundation classes and MSVCR90D.dll is the MS C runtime library, both as debug variant.
    So all the DLLs you mention are actually MS DLLs! You haven't identified the DLL that you try to access in LabVIEW that causes these error messages. IESHIMS and WER are usually delay loaded by any component that needs it and should not likely be used by non MS code.
    What is the DLL you try to load into LabVIEW and by whom? Get the provider of that DLL to provide you a non Debug build of the DLL. Installing Visual C on all the machines just to make the DLL load is not a solution, besides that it is likely not legal since I doubt you have that many licenses.
